Residential property is a single-family house or structure with 4 property units or less (i. e. duplex, triplex, 4-plex) that has specific(s) or household(ies) as tenants. A commercial residential or commercial property is any home that has commercial companies as occupants or a multifamily complex with 5 or more systems. Both a domestic and a commercial home will be zoned accordingly with the county it is located in.

The laws surrounding own a home and domestic leasing (i. e. landlord-tenant laws) are totally various than the laws surrounding industrial real estate. In nearly all states, landlord-tenant law heavily favors the tenant in matters involving disclosure, expulsion, and repairs/maintenance; residential landlords generally have a greater threshold of duty than business proprietors. 5. Although it's fairly easy to purchase your own house or a rental property with little to no experience, it is much more challenging to own and run a commercial residential or commercial property without any experience. Business homes require a minimum of a fundamental understanding of location rents, renter settlements, cost management, home maintenance, and financial analysis to make certain necessary returns are being met.

Medical office is expert space and can be the most important and stable financial investments in the workplace world. Occupants here can be any organization from your local dental expert to significant surgery centers and medical facilities. Medical occupants tend to - upwards of $200+ per square foot, due to the requirements of their industry and the high-standard of aesthetics. Given that medical tenants frequently require more pipes, larger elevators, and other specialized facilities, these leases tend to be 7-10+ years.
